You change it using the drain and top-up method, just like a regular oil change. But it takes 3 drains of 3 liters each to drain out most of the fluid. And its best to do each drain several weeks apart so the tranny can slowly acclimate to the new introduction fluid, otherwise you risk slippage problems.
Use the DW-1 fluid from honda or acura, whichever is sold cheaper. Always top up on a level surface between the marks...about 3 bottles.
You will need a breaker bar to loosen that drain bolt the first time. Hand tighten with a wrench or ratchet, ...do not overtighten or you risk stripping the aluminum threads.
And don't forget to change the black cylindrical tranny filter sitting on top of the tranny under the air intake hose. See the detailed diy for this.

I agree, with 180kmile on trans stay with HONDA DW-1 atf
the trans will only drain 3 to 3.4 us qts at a time
total capacity is 7
depending on current fluid age and condition you may want to do 1 times (x) 3 qts
and see how it reacts
see the many fluid and trans failure threads for info
also see threads on new member for lots of tips
Are you having any slipping or shudder in shifting?
engine oil- any brand oil is fine, stay with 5-30 for most areas

the owner manual gives the CORRECT way to ck fluid level in trans--its not normal!
if the trans is near death a full change of all fluid -the 3x3- will put the last nail in the coffin
If all is well, all new fluid at once wont hurt
BEST thing to do as a new owner is drain 3 ounces of atf and send to blackstone labs (look up online) with 20 bucks for a mass spectrograph reading of the fluid
they will tell you if anything bad is happening inside the trans or not
money well spent
Worst thing to do = add trans purr of any type!!! very picky transmission
use only honda dw1
